Artist Bio:
Quarterflash is an American rock band formed in Portland, Oregon in 1980. The band was founded by husband and wife duo, Rindy and Marv Ross. Rindy Ross is the lead vocalist and saxophonist for the band, while Marv Ross plays guitar. The band's name, Quarterflash, is a nod to an Australian slang term for a native American.
Quarterflash is best known for their hit songs "Harden My Heart" and "Find Another Fool", both of which were top 20 hits in the United States in the early 1980s. The band's music is characterized by a blend of rock, pop, and new wave elements, with Rindy Ross's distinctive vocals and saxophone playing being standout features. Quarterflash released several albums throughout the 1980s and continued to perform and release music into the 2000s.
